Output 32a43531df710e31e4bfc6cc15a5682f895dfa1d749326f7ea908a02a5e29ff5:0

value
21822606
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06cfe49a61e3e0587afc634e723b5a2a59323e06 OP_EQUALVERIFY OP_CHECKSIG
address
1d26otqWXALSU39s9bKC9tPuUWP27pnxD
transaction
32a43531df710e31e4bfc6cc15a5682f895dfa1d749326f7ea908a02a5e29ff5
spent
true